Weather in June

June, the first month of the winter in Newcastle, is still a refreshing month, with an average temperature ranging between max 18°C (64.4°F) and min 4.9°C (40.8°F).

Temperature

June and July, when the average high-temperature reaches 18°C (64.4°F), are the coldest months.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in June is 49%.

Rainfall

In Newcastle, during June, the rain falls for 2.3 days and regularly aggregates up to 5mm (0.2") of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Newcastle, there are 117.9 rainfall days, and 347mm (13.66")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

With an average of 10h and 24min of daylight, June has the shortest days of the year in Newcastle.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:43 and sunset at 17:12. On the last day of June, in Newcastle, sunrise is at 06:51 and sunset at 17:16 SAST.

Sunshine

In June, the average sunshine is 7.6h.

UV index

May through July, with an average maximum UV index of 4,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: The average daily UV index of 4 in June transforms into the following instructions:
Proceed with care. Light skin individuals may be exposed to burns in fewer than 30 minutes. To guard against the harmful effects of the Sun, minimize exposure during midday. Wearing a wide-brim hat can block approximately 50% of UV radiation, protecting the eyes.
